Parents who bought cheap LED finger lights for their children now face a direct safety warning from federal regulators: the button cell batteries inside can be pried loose by small hands, creating a risk of serious injury or death if swallowed. The U.S. Consumer Product Safety Commission has recalled approximately 14,400 units of LED Finger Beam Lights sold by ZMC Group, model A10-8, which were available from August 2025 through March 2026. A separate recall targets similar projecting LED finger light toys sold on Amazon by a seller called POPOOO. Both products violate the mandatory federal safety standard for children’s toys because their battery compartments fail to keep button cells inaccessible.
Why these battery-access failures triggered federal action
The hazard is not theoretical. Button cell batteries, when swallowed, can lodge in a child’s esophagus and cause severe chemical burns within two hours. Death is a documented outcome. That risk is exactly why federal law requires toys to meet ASTM F963, the voluntary industry standard that Congress made mandatory for children’s toys under Section 106 of the Consumer Product Safety Improvement Act. The standard is codified at 16 C.F.R. part 1250, and it includes specific requirements for how battery compartments must be secured so children cannot open them without a tool.
ZMC Group’s LED Finger Beam Lights failed that test. The CPSC’s recall notice states that the button cell batteries inside are “easily accessed by children,” which means the compartment design did not meet the screw-secured or tool-required standard that ASTM F963 demands. The POPOOO projecting finger lights failed on the same grounds. Both products were sold online, a distribution channel where low-cost imported toys can reach consumers with minimal retail gatekeeping.
The timing of these recalls sits within a broader regulatory tightening around battery safety. Reese’s Law, signed in 2022, created a separate federal rule for non-toy consumer products containing button or coin batteries, codified at 16 C.F.R. part 1263 and incorporating the ANSI/UL 4200A-2023 performance standard. Toys that comply with the existing toy standard under 16 C.F.R. part 1250 are exempt from Reese’s Law requirements. But that exemption only applies when the toy actually meets the standard. Products like the recalled finger lights, which violate ASTM F963, lose that safe harbor and face enforcement from both directions.
What the recall records show about ZMC Group and POPOOO
The CPSC’s recall of ZMC Group’s LED Finger Beam Lights covers approximately 14,400 units of the A10-8 model. The sales window ran from August 2025 through March 2026. The recall notice explicitly states the product “violates mandatory standard for toys,” a phrase the CPSC uses when a product fails a binding federal requirement rather than a voluntary guideline. The recalled lights were marketed as colorful, wearable beams that slip over a child’s finger, making them especially appealing at parties, school events, and holiday celebrations.
The parallel recall of projecting LED finger light toys sold by POPOOO on Amazon carries the same regulatory language and the same hazard description: button cell batteries accessible to children, posing ingestion risk. Neither recall notice reports confirmed injuries or deaths tied to these specific products. The absence of reported incidents does not diminish the enforcement basis. The CPSC can and does recall products that violate mandatory standards before injuries occur, treating the design defect itself as the actionable hazard.
Both recalls trace to the same structural problem. These are inexpensive, battery-powered novelty items marketed to children, often sold in bulk packs at low price points through online marketplaces. The battery compartments lack the secured closures that ASTM F963 requires. For a product that costs a few dollars, the engineering margin between a compliant and non-compliant battery door can be razor thin, and manufacturers or importers cutting costs on closure mechanisms create exactly the gap regulators are now targeting.
How federal standards are supposed to prevent this
Under federal law, any toy intended for children 12 and under must comply with ASTM F963 and be tested by a CPSC-accepted laboratory before it is imported or sold. Importers and domestic manufacturers are then required to issue a Children’s Product Certificate attesting that the toy meets all applicable rules. The toy standard includes mechanical and physical testing of battery compartments, including torque and tension tests designed to mimic the pulling, twisting, and prying forces a child might apply.
For button and coin batteries in non-toy products, Reese’s Law adds parallel requirements. The implementing rule, found in 16 C.F.R. part 1263, incorporates the ANSI/UL 4200A-2023 performance standard, which focuses on secure battery enclosures, clear labeling, and warnings on both packaging and instructions. These overlapping regimes are meant to close loopholes: a product marketed as a toy must meet the toy rule, while a household gadget with a similar battery must meet the Reese’s Law standard.
In theory, a product like an LED finger light should be caught at multiple points: during design, in third-party lab testing, at customs inspection, and through marketplace compliance checks. The fact that tens of thousands of units reached consumers suggests that at least one of those checkpoints failed, and possibly several. Whether the issue lies in inadequate testing, falsified certifications, or weak marketplace oversight remains unclear from the public record.
Gaps in enforcement data and what parents should do now
Several questions remain open. Neither recall notice includes details about corrective action plans, third-party testing documentation, or how these products cleared import channels without pre-market compliance verification. The CPSC’s toy safety guidance makes clear that ASTM F963 compliance is mandatory and must be certified by an accredited laboratory before toys enter the U.S. market. How products that violate the standard reached consumers through established online platforms points to a gap between certification requirements on paper and actual supply-chain enforcement.
The recall notices also do not specify whether the CPSC identified these violations through its own surveillance, marketplace monitoring, or reports filed through SaferProducts.gov. That distinction matters because it speaks to whether the agency is catching non-compliant products proactively or primarily after consumer complaints. Without that information, parents are left to assume that some unsafe products will slip through and that vigilance at home remains a critical backstop.
For families, the immediate steps are straightforward. Anyone who purchased the recalled ZMC Group or POPOOO finger lights should remove them from children’s reach immediately and follow the recall instructions for refunds or replacements. Parents should also treat any inexpensive toy or novelty item containing button or coin batteries with caution, especially if the battery door lacks a visible screw or appears loose. If a child is suspected of swallowing a button battery, emergency care is urgent; medical guidance emphasizes going directly to an emergency department rather than waiting for symptoms.
Longer term, the recalls highlight the importance of checking for compliance information before buying toys online. Listings should identify the manufacturer or importer, the age grading, and any safety certifications. While consumers cannot independently verify every claim, the absence of basic compliance details on a product page is itself a warning sign. In a marketplace where small, low-cost electronics can be listed and relisted under shifting brand names, that kind of skepticism is increasingly a necessary part of parenting.
Ultimately, the LED finger light recalls underscore a familiar tension in consumer protection: low prices and rapid online distribution can outpace the systems designed to keep products safe. Federal standards for toys and button batteries are in place and, on paper, robust. Their effectiveness depends on consistent enforcement and on manufacturers treating safety requirements as non-negotiable design constraints rather than optional costs. Until that gap is fully closed, parents will remain the last line of defense between a child and a battery small enough to swallow but dangerous enough to kill.
